Lions claim Barry Turner off waivers from Bears
Brad Biggs
The Detroit Lions aren’t going to be able to find a player in the final four weeks of the season that can replace the production and energy Kyle Vanden Bosch brings to the game.
But they have found a developmental prospect they can look to for the future. Vanden Bosch will be placed on injured reserve with a bulging disc in his neck. He will require surgery, coach Jim Schwartz announced. Cornerback Alphonso Smith was also placed on IR with a shoulder injury.
Filling one spot will be rookie defensive end Barry Turner. He was claimed off waivers from the Chicago Bears. The undrafted free agent from Nebraska was waived Tuesday so the Bears could make room for offensive lineman Herman Johnson. Turner appeared in two games for the Bears, and they were committed to re-signing him to their practice squad.
